If it was a computer file, look in your recycle bin.
If it was an email, look in your deleted items folder
If it was downloaded from an email attachment, you may still have the email and therefore, a backup.

ACCIDENTLY DELETED MY LOCK

Just google "rescue my files"
Lots of sites are offering software to recover deleted files, or even files from a formatted drive.
Be aware, if you did write anything on the drive after formatting, it will decrease the chance of and the amount of files you can rescue.
Most sites offer a trail version wich you should use first, to see if there is still something to rescue. To my knowledge there were some good freeware programs, but not sure they are still there. I use a paid version, since I deleted a drive by accident
